Output 6df4c57799fe24a7a4b2052c2a0892a671aebe4aca7df6d4610e94a77727eb34:2

value
19824592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5a60e08d4e51cafb78bdfe0aaa2e4e8e5f744db OP_EQUAL
address
MQTdTqqUmBiewRDTDKHTQxmadvaTuDAWTA
transaction
6df4c57799fe24a7a4b2052c2a0892a671aebe4aca7df6d4610e94a77727eb34
spent
true